To remove an existing padding material quickly without causing any trouble such as cracks on a base material of a crushing member such as a crushing roller.
A degraded padded section is removed by scanning a worn existing padding material 8 of crushing members 1, 12 by an arc 5 of a plasma gauging device 3 while securing a remained padding material 9 having a designated thickness t from a worn surface 6 of a base material 2. The existing padding material 8 is difficult to remove with a general rotary grinding wheel since consisting of a raw material with high wear resistance and having hardness further increased by a work-hardening phenomenon, however, the arc 5 can shortly remove the existing padding material 8 at high removing efficiency. Furthermore, the trouble such as breaking and cracks on the base material 2 caused by processing heat and fusion heat can be prevented to the utmost extent since the remained padding material 9 exerts an effect of a heat shielding material for preventing excessive transmission of the processing heat by the arc 5 and the fusion heat upon melting a newly-established padding material 10 to the base material 2.
